There is an > undefined binding (HelloServerBinding) in the WSDL document. > > > Nitesh, > > > > I agree that your QNames look okay, but there are quite a few > > problems with > > your WSDL. You've got a serious mix and match of RPC/encoded and > > document/literal definitions. > > > > I think your specific error is caused by the way you've defined your > > <soap:body> elements: > > > > <soap:body > > encodingStyle="http://schemas.xmlsoap.org/soap/encoding/" > > namesapce="http://craft.epfl.ch/wsdl/HelloServer.wsdl" > > use="literal"/> > > > > 1) you have "namespace" spelled wrong (so perhaps wsdl2java > > ignored the > > binding definition -- hence no binding was defined) > > 2) you should not use the "encodingStyle" and the "namespace" > > attributes on > > document/literal bindings. > > > > Your <soap:body> elements should be defined like this: > > > > <soap:body use="literal"/> > > > > You also have typos in some of your message names: > > > > <message name="sayHellToRequest"> > > <part name="name" type="xsd:string"/> > > </message> > > > > Some basic guidelines for doc/literal bindings: > > - Don't use the soapenc:array type. Define your own array using the > > minOccurs and maxOccurs attributes. > > - You have only one message part per message. That message part must > > reference an element definition rather than a type definition. > > - To use the Wrapped style, the referenced element definition > must > > have the > > same name as the portType operation name. The element must be > > defined as a > > <sequence>. The operation parameters are defined as elements > > within the > > sequence. > > > > For example, your addRequest message should be defined like this: > > > > <message name="addRequest"> > > <part name="parameters" element="tns:add"/> > > </message> > > > > And the add element should be defined like this: > > > > <element name="add"> > > <complexType> > > <sequence> > > <element name="num1" type="xsd:int"/> > > <element name="num2" type="xsd:int"/> > > </sequence> > > </complexType> > > </element> > > > > I suggest you get a WSDL editor to help you define your WSDL > > documents.
